## Releases

StormRelay fan-out builds are cut from the `stable` branch every two weeks. Each release bundles the alert dispatcher, the regional topic router, and the retry sidecar into a single signed tarball. Severity thresholds and fan-out limits are frozen at tag time and recorded in the release manifest. Security reviewers should confirm that the manifest hash matches the tag annotation before approving distribution to the Kestrelbay mirrors. All artifacts are verified against the release signing key shown below.

signing key of yahop-kajeg = bky19_kGEQSkL2VKL1WQYJhcX

### v3.8.1 — Gatehouse internal API gateway

Tightened rate limiting on the /batch endpoints after last week's retry storm nearly toasted the Parqet backend. Limits are now per-team tokens instead of per-IP, so expect a few 429s from older clients until they update. On-call: if limits need a temporary bump, ping the owner below before touching anything.

named custodian: Brivan Eliath Quenox Frador

**Action item PM-112-4 (owner: Deyan, due end of sprint)**

Heads up for whoever picks this up — probably you, since you're new: the Nightcrane backfill scheduler currently retries failed jobs with no backoff, which is what hammered the warehouse during the outage. We need exponential backoff plus a circuit breaker after five consecutive failures. Don't worry about the cron syntax quirks; they're weird but documented. Full context on how Nightcrane schedules jobs, including the retry state machine diagram, is on the internal page below.

operations page: https://confluence.tolvaqlabs.internal/projects/projects/projects/browse